Zhuhai Gree Equity Investment Fund Management

Zhuhai Gree Equity Investment Fund Management functions as the dedicated private equity and venture capital investment platform of Zhuhai Gree Group, the state-owned enterprise headquartered in Zhuhai, Guangdong. Established as a vehicle to deploy capital into strategically aligned sectors, the firm channels Gree Group’s industrial heritage into portfolio companies spanning advanced manufacturing, industrial automation, semiconductors, and new energy technologies. The platform operates with a dual mandate: generating financial returns while advancing the parent group’s positioning within China’s self-sufficiency-driven technology ecosystem. The firm’s investment strategy concentrates on early-stage, expansion, and late-stage opportunities, executing both direct equity investments and strategic co-investments. Asset-class exposure centers on growth equity and venture capital, with particular emphasis on hard-tech industrial verticals. The firm has participated in capital deployments tied to Gree’s broader push into semiconductor equipment and new-energy vehicle components. Documented portfolio activity includes backing semiconductor materials suppliers and industrial-automation integrators that align with Gree’s own factory-modernization priorities. Geographic focus remains heavily domestic, centered on the Greater Bay Area and select tier-1 industrial provinces, though select transactions extend to cross-border technology transfer deals. Scale and team metrics are not publicly disclosed, consistent with the firm’s operation as a captive corporate investment unit rather than a third-party fund manager. The parent entity, Gree Group, is a state-owned conglomerate with interests spanning home appliances, electrical equipment, and industrial components. Adjacent vehicles include Gree Group’s publicly listed operating company, Gree Electric Appliances Inc. of Zhuhai, and a network of industrial subsidiaries that co-invest alongside the equity platform. No independent fund structures marketed to external limited partners have been publicly documented. In the current cycle, the firm has reportedly deepened its allocation to chip-design and wafer-fabrication assets, timed to China’s intensified domestic semiconductor substitution push. The firm’s structural differentiator lies in its identity as a corporate venture capital platform embedded within a state-owned industrial conglomerate. Unlike financial sponsors, Zhuhai Gree Equity Investment provides portfolio companies with access to Gree’s manufacturing footprint, procurement channels, and R&D infrastructure. This operating-group integration creates a strategic co-investor dynamic where investee companies often become suppliers or joint-development partners to the parent group, aligning financial returns with industrial-policy objectives in ways that pure-fund structures cannot replicate.

Frequently asked questions

Is Zhuhai Gree Equity Investment a fund manager for third-party limited partners?

No, the firm operates as a captive corporate private equity platform for Zhuhai Gree Group. It deploys capital directly from the parent conglomerate's balance sheet rather than raising commingled blind-pool funds from external institutional investors. This structure means its investment pace, hold periods, and return targets are governed by Gree Group’s strategic objectives, not by fund-life constraints.

How does the firm's relationship with Gree Electric Appliances shape its deal flow?

Gree Electric Appliances Inc. of Zhuhai is the publicly listed operating entity under Gree Group, and its sprawling manufacturing supply chain generates proprietary deal flow for the equity investment platform. Portfolio companies often gain access to Gree’s factory automation needs, component procurement volumes, and distribution networks, making the firm a strategic co-investor rather than a purely financial one.

What sectors does the firm actively avoid?

Public disclosures suggest the firm avoids consumer internet, advertising-based platforms, and asset-light service models inconsistent with Gree Group’s industrial DNA. There is no documented activity in sectors such as gaming, social media, or pure-play software-as-a-service businesses detached from the hardware-manufacturing value chain.

Who makes investment decisions at Zhuhai Gree Equity Investment?

Investment decision-makers have not been publicly named. Governance likely rests with a committee drawn from Gree Group senior management and the equity investment unit’s own leadership, reflecting standard Chinese state-owned enterprise practice where major capital allocations require parent-level approval. Specific identities of the investment committee remain undisclosed in English-language or accessible Chinese-language public records.

Does the firm pursue cross-border investments outside mainland China?

The firm’s investment posture is overwhelmingly domestic, focused on China’s Greater Bay Area and industrial provinces. Any cross-border activity appears limited to technology-transfer transactions involving semiconductor and advanced-manufacturing assets, aligned with China’s stated policy of acquiring strategic intellectual property for domestic substitution. Such transactions are likely structured with significant mainland control retained.
